| Abstract: | Views of the Hollywood Victory Caravan's (also referred to as
Stars of Victory Caravan) appearances in Minneapolis and St. Paul in May 1942. The
caravan included motion picture actors and actresses and entertainers who traveled the
country raising funds for the war effort. Views include the stars arrival and greeting
by crowds of fans, posed photographs, and the Army Navy Relief Show in Minneapolis.
Stars included Eleanor Powell, Bert Lahr, Groucho Marx, Rise Stevens, Desi Arnaz, Stan
Laurel, Oliver Hardy, Joan Bennett, Joan Blondell, Claudette Colbert, Charles Boyer,
Cary Grant, Pat O'Brien, Bing Crosby, Merle Oberon, Olivia de Havilland, James Cagney,
and Bob Hope. Printed from negatives removed from the Minneapolis newspapers negative
collection at the Minnesota Historical Society. |
